Работа с электронными таблицами часто сталкивается с проблемой различий в региональных стандартах. В русскоязычной версии программы по умолчанию используется запятая для отделения дробной части, что может вызывать путаницу при импорте данных из зарубежных источников. Пользователи, привыкшие к англо-американскому формату, часто ищут способ, как в экселе записать число с точкой, чтобы избежать ошибок при вычислениях.
Некорректное отображение разделителя может привести к тому, что программа воспримет число как текст, и математические операции станут невозможны. Это особенно актуально при копировании данных из веб-сайтов или других баз данных, где используется точка. В этом материале мы подробно разберем все способы изменения настроек, чтобы разделитель соответствовал вашим требованиям.
Изменение этого параметра затрагивает не только визуальное отображение, но и логику работы формул. Понимание принципов работы локальных настроек Excel позволит вам избежать множества ошибок в будущем. Далее мы рассмотрим пошаговые инструкции для разных версий программы.
Глобальная смена разделителя через параметры Excel
Самый надежный способ изменить символ, разделяющий целую и дробную части, кроется в глубоких настройках самого приложения. Этот метод изменит поведение программы для всех открываемых файлов на данном компьютере. Чтобы попасть в нужное меню, необходимо перейти на вкладку Файл и выбрать пункт Параметры в самом низу списка.
В открывшемся окне следует выбрать категорию Дополнительно. Именно здесь находятся ключевые настройки редактирования. Найдите блок под названием "Параметры правки". Там вы увидите галочку "Использовать системные разделители". Если вы хотите вручную задать точку, эту галочку нужно снять.
После снятия флажка станут активны поля для ручного ввода. В поле "Разделитель целой и дробной части" введите точку. Обратите внимание, что символ-разделитель аргументов функций (обычно точка с запятой) также может потребовать изменения на запятую, чтобы формулы работали корректно. После внесения изменений нажмите OK.
☑️ Проверка настроек региона
Важно понимать, что данная настройка является глобальной. Она повлияет на то, как программа интерпретирует ввод данных с клавиатуры. Если вы введете 3.14, Excel поймет это как число три целых четырнадцать сотых. Если же оставить запятую, то ввод точки может быть воспринят как текст или дата.
⚠️ Внимание: После смены глобального разделителя старые формулы, в которых жестко прописаны запятые (например, в текстовом формате), могут перестать работать корректно. Проверьте критически важные расчеты после внесения изменений.
Настройка региональных стандартов Windows
Часто пользователи предпочитают не менять настройки внутри офисного пакета, а привести в соответствие системные требования операционной системы. Excel по умолчанию наследует параметры региона из Windows. Это означает, что изменение настройки в панели управления затронет не только таблицы, но и другие программы, использующие системные стандарты.
Для этого откройте панель управления и найдите пункт "Регион" или "Язык и региональные стандарты". В зависимости от версии Windows интерфейс может отличаться, но суть остается той же. Вам нужна вкладка "Дополнительные параметры" или кнопка "Дополнительные настройки даты, времени и числа".
В открывшемся окне найдите поле "Разделитель целой и дробной части". Замените запятую на точку. Также рекомендуется проверить символ разделения групп разрядов — обычно это пробел или запятая. Убедитесь, что символы не дублируются, чтобы не возникло конфликтов при отображении больших чисел.
После применения настроек может потребоваться перезапуск Excel. Системный подход хорош тем, что он един для всех приложений. Однако, если вы работаете в международной компании, где файлы открываются на компьютерах с разными настройками, лучше использовать форматирование внутри самой таблицы.
Использование текстового формата для импорта данных
Иногда нет возможности менять глобальные настройки, например, при работе на чужом компьютере или в корпоративной сети с ограничениями. В таких случаях, чтобы записать число с точкой, можно использовать хитрость с форматированием ячеек. Если вы введете число, начинающееся с апострофа ', например '12.34, Excel сохранит его как текст, но визуально точка останется.
Однако, такой метод превращает число в текстовую строку, и математические операции с ним производиться не будут. Чтобы решить эту проблему, можно предварительно отформатировать ячейки. Выделите нужный диапазон, нажмите Ctrl+1 и выберите "Текстовый" формат. Теперь ввод точки будет восприниматься буквально.
Если же вам нужно именно числовое значение, но с точкой, придется использовать формулы замены. Например, функция ПОДСТАВИТЬ (или SUBSTITUTE в английской версии) может заменить точку на запятую, после чего текст преобразуется в число. Но это уже обходные пути, а не прямое решение задачи отображения.
Для временного отображения данных, пришедших из базы данных, часто используют следующий трюк: меняют формат ячейки на "Текстовый", вставляют данные, а затем с помощью "Текста по столбцам" конвертируют их обратно в числа, указав нужный разделитель.
| Метод | Влияние на вычисления | Сложность | Рекомендуемое использование |
|---|---|---|---|
| Параметры Excel | Полное (числа) | Низкая | Постоянная работа |
| Настройки Windows | Полное (числа) | Средняя | Глобальная смена языка |
| Апостроф перед числом | Отсутствует (текст) | Низкая | Единичные записи |
| Формулы замены | Требует конвертации | Высокая | Обработка импорта |
Проблемы с формулами и аргументами функций
Одной из самых частых ошибок при смене разделителя является путаница в аргументах функций. В русской локализации Excel аргументы функций разделяются точкой с запятой ;, а в английской — запятой ,. Если вы меняете десятичный разделитель на точку, логично, что разделителем аргументов должна стать запятая.
Если этого не сделать, формула вида =СУММ(1.5; 2.5) может выдать ошибку, так как программа будет ждать запятую между аргументами. В результате выражение превратится в =СУММ(1.5, 2.5). Это критически важный нюанс при переходе на "английский" стиль ввода чисел.
При копировании формул из интернета (где часто используется американский стандарт) в русскую версию Excel с стандартными настройками, вы столкнетесь с ошибкой #ЗНАЧ!. Программа не поймет, что точка внутри числа — это разделитель, а не часть синтаксиса функции.
Почему формула не работает?
Если вы видите ошибку #ЗНАЧ! после вставки формулы, проверьте, какой символ стоит между аргументами. Возможно, вам нужно заменить все точки с запятой на запятые, или наоборот, в зависимости от ваших текущих настроек региона.
Чтобы избежать хаоса в формулах, опытные пользователи часто создают шаблонный файл, где все настройки уже приведены к единому стандарту. Это позволяет не думать о синтаксисе каждый раз заново. Также полезно использовать именованные диапазоны, которые меньше зависят от региональных настроек.
Конвертация данных при импорте из CSV
Особая категория проблем возникает при загрузке данных из текстовых файлов формата CSV. Часто такие файлы создаются в системах, где разделителем является точка, а в вашем Excel — запятая. При прямом открытии файла все числа могут "слипнуться" или быть восприняты как даты.
Для правильного открытия используйте мастер текстов. Перейдите на вкладку Данные, выберите Получить данные или Из текста/CSV. В открывшемся окне импорта можно явно указать кодировку и разделители. В поле "Разделитель" выберите точку или укажите ее вручную.
На этапе предпросмотра вы увидите, как Excel разобьет текст на столбцы. Если числа в столбце с дробями отображаются корректно (с точкой), значит, настройка прошла успешно. На последнем шаге мастера можно задать формат данных для каждого столбца, выбрав "Общий" или "Числовой".
Если файл уже открыт и данные выглядят неправильно (например, 12,5 превратилось в 12 мая или текст), используйте функцию "Текст по столбцам". Выделите столбец, перейдите в Данные → Текст по столбцам. На третьем шаге мастера укажите нужный разделитель и формат.
⚠️ Внимание: При импорте больших массивов данных убедитесь, что в файле нет смешанного использования разделителей. Если в одном файле часть чисел записана с точкой, а часть с запятой, автоматическая конвертация может привести к потере данных.
Восстановление стандартных настроек
Бывают ситуации, когда эксперименты с форматами зашли слишком далеко, и таблица перестала вести себя предсказуемо. Вернуть все к исходному состоянию можно через те же меню, где производилась настройка. Если вы меняли параметры Windows, верните запятую в системные настройки.
Если изменения вносились только в Excel, снова зайдите в Параметры → Дополнительно. Поставьте галочку "Использовать системные разделители". Это действие мгновенно сбросит пользовательские настройки программы на значения, принятые в операционной системе.
Стоит отметить, что сброс настроек не исправит уже введенные данные. Если вы вводили числа с точкой, пока была активна соответствующая настройка, они останутся числами. Если вы вводили их как текст (с апострофом), они так и останутся текстом, и потребуется дополнительная конвертация.
Для гарантированной чистоты эксперимента перед сменой настроек рекомендуется сохранить важный файл в формате XLSX, закрыть его и открыть заново. Это позволит увидеть, как новые правила применяются к новым данным.
Часто задаваемые вопросы (FAQ)
Почему при вводе точки Excel автоматически меняет ее на запятую?
Это происходит потому, что в ваших текущих региональных настройках Windows или параметрах Excel в качестве десятичного разделителя установлена запятая. Программа автоматически заменяет точку на запятую, чтобы привести число к стандартному для системы виду.
Можно ли сделать так, чтобы в одном файле были и точки, и запятые?
В рамках одной книги Excel и одного сеанса работы глобально разделить эти символы нельзя. Однако, можно имитировать это, используя текстовый формат для ячеек с точкой, но проводить вычисления с ними будет невозможно без предварительной конвертации.
Как быстро переключиться между форматами при работе с разными файлами?
Быстрее всего это делать через панель управления Windows, но это затронет все программы. Внутри Excel быстрого переключателя "одной кнопкой" нет, поэтому для разных стандартов часто создают отдельные профили пользователей Windows или используют макросы для смены настроек.
Влияет ли смена разделителя на печать документов?
Да, влияет. При печати отображается то значение, которое находится в ячейке. Если вы настроили точку как разделитель, то и на бумаге числа будут напечатаны с точкой. Визуальное представление полностью зависит от настроек формата.
Что делать, если формула СУММ не видит числа с точкой?
Скорее всего, программа воспринимает эти записи как текст. Проверьте выравнивание в ячейке (текст обычно прижат влево). Используйте функцию ЗНАЧЕН или умножение на 1, чтобы принудительно конвертировать текст в число, предварительно заменив разделитель на правильный для вашей системы.